Alfajores Dulce de Leche Sandwich Cookies – Easy Latin American Dessert Recipe
Alfajores dulce de leche sandwich cookies are a beloved Latin American treat! Buttery, crumbly cookies filled with rich dulce de leche and finished with a dusting of powdered sugar make these irresistible for holidays, parties, or everyday indulgence. A simple yet elegant dessert that melts in your mouth.
Prep Time 15 minutes mins
Total Time 1 hour hr 5 minutes mins
Course Dessert, Festive Gift, Tea Time Treat
Cuisine Argentine/Peruvian/Uruguayan, South American
Servings 24 sandwich cookies
Calories 180 kcal
Mixing bowls
Electric mixer or whisk
Rolling Pin
Cookie cutter (round)
Baking sheet
Parchment paper
Airtight container
- 1 cup unsalted butter, softened
- ¾ cup sugar
- 2 egg yolks
- 1 tsp vanilla extract
- 1½ cups all-purpose flour
- 2 cups cornstarch
- 1 tsp baking powder
- Pinch of salt
- 1½ cups dulce de leche (homemade or store-bought)
- Optional garnishes: shredded coconut, powdered sugar, melted chocolate
Make Dough: Cream butter and sugar until fluffy. Add egg yolks and vanilla. Mix in flour, cornstarch, baking powder, and salt until soft dough forms.
Chill Dough: Wrap in plastic and refrigerate for 30 minutes.
Roll & Cut: Roll dough to ¼-inch thickness. Cut into rounds with cookie cutter.
Bake: Place on parchment-lined baking sheet. Bake at 350°F (175°C) for 8–10 minutes until pale golden. Cool completely.
Fill: Spread dulce de leche on one cookie, sandwich with another.
Garnish: Roll edges in coconut, dust with powdered sugar, or dip in chocolate.
Rest: Store in airtight container overnight for flavors to meld.
-
Chocolate-dipped alfajores add decadence.
-
Nutty version: roll edges in crushed hazelnuts or almonds.
-
Add citrus zest to dough for brightness.
-
Vegan option: use coconut caramel and plant-based shortbread.
-
Mini alfajores are perfect for party platters.
-
Store unfilled cookies in freezer for up to 1 month.
Keyword alfajores recipe, dulce de leche cookies, holiday cookies, sandwich cookies, South American desserts